... | in breadcrumbs_menu_item.naml |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32
|
<subroutine name="breadcrumbs_menu_item" requires="basic,nabble,node">
<n.set_local_node.this_node/>
<n.subapps_list.>
<n.limited_loop start="0" length="5">
<do>
<n.set_var. name="has_subapps"><n.compress.>
<n.all_true.>
<n.current_node.has_subapps/>
<n.current_node.has_permission group="[n.anyone_group/]" permission="[n.view_permission/]"/>
</n.all_true.>
</n.compress.></n.set_var.>
<li class="[n.if.var name='has_subapps'][then]has-subapps[/then][/n.if.var] depth-[n.call_depth/] node-id-[n.current_node.id/]" data-node-id="[n.current_node.id/]">
<n.current_node.node_link class="nowrap"/> <span class="has-subapps-indicator">»</span>
<n.if.var name="has_subapps">
<then>
<n.if.not.call_depth.is_greater_than i="4">
<then>
<ul class="shaded-bg-color">
<n.current_node.breadcrumbs_menu_item/>
</ul>
</then>
</n.if.not.call_depth.is_greater_than>
</then>
</n.if.var>
</li>
</do>
<if_truncated>
<li><n.local_node.node_link class="nowrap" text="More..."/></li>
</if_truncated>
</n.limited_loop>
</n.subapps_list.>
</subroutine>
|
Free forum by Nabble | Naml |